Race is probably not that important for warriors compared to most other professions. Even if you choose CoL you probably won't need to worry about spirit regen much, and +/- 30 AS is not really game changing.

If you've been playing characters with decent logic, switching to a half krolvin will probably be pretty painful if you like to watch your absorption numbers.

My main character is a burghal gnome warrior, and I've tried making various half krolvin characters over the years, but the logic just depresses me. They really have great stats other than that, but you're looking at 5 less exp per pulse on a node when compared to a gnome.

If I was going to pick a short race for warrior I'd pick a halfling, a bit less maneuver defense then a b-gnome with extra elemental and sorc TD, they also have slightly better dex. That +30 AS difference between a halfling and a giantman is quite noticeable, however, for most things at cap you don't need a huge AS to kill them either. In Nelemar I often walk around with a 528 killing things, I only bother to increase it further when I am hunting GWE and sentries, or just when I feel like it. Hunting plane four of the rift about the same thing, in the scatter you definitely want as much AS as you can get though. I've been back to hunting OTF lately and find myself pushing my AS up there just because WoF is annoying and it is easier to cut through it then bother knocking things down and giving them an extra chance to fade.
